Description Hansel and his sister gathered wood in the forest, but it's nothing compared to what Hansol Paper must amass to run its mills. A division of Korean conglomerate Hansol Corporation, Hansol Paper manufactures printing and writing paper, paperboard for industrial use, and specialty paper. The company exports more than 50% of its production to the US, Japan, and 50 other countries. It operates three mills (its Janghang mill is the largest printing and writing paper mill in Korea) and has offices in Korea, China, and the US. Hansol picked up a near 40% stake in paper manufacturer EN Paper from Kukil Paper in 2008. The company, established in 1965 as Saehan Paper Manufacturing, was part of the Samsung Group until 1993.
